7 peoplePublished under the title Maou na Ore to Ghoulish Princess no Yubiwa, this HJ Bunko Grand Prize winner follows high-school student Chiharu Kuzumi after he is chosen as a monster tamer. Surrounded by girls who carry monster powers, he is drawn into a comic fantasy struggle over his potential to become the strongest tamer, the Demon King.
A battle-romantic comedy that begins with a mysterious message and a houseful of monster girls.
Published as Samurai Blood: Tenshu Musou, this Japanese-style magical battle fantasy is set centuries after Oda Nobunaga unified Japan through onmyodo. Kachou, daughter of the Asai dojo, and the blind boy Ryu enter a world of formidable warriors known as bushi.
In a Japan reshaped by onmyodo, a spectacular battle among supernatural warriors begins.
Published as Anuvis! Koushite Ore wa Saikyou no Death Worm ni Narimashita, this offbeat cohabitation romantic comedy begins when a boy accidentally revives a beautiful mummy girl. A wish-granting promise sends him through bizarre fantasy detours, including transformation into a Mongolian death worm.
A chance encounter with a mummy girl tumbles into unpredictable fantasy chaos.
Published as Akahagane no Evoluther, this military fantasy follows Rios, one of the rare warriors able to use magic as an Evoluther. Transferred to an island posting, he is caught in a rebellion and fights alongside a rookie dragoon and an engineer.
On a rebellious island, Evoluthers and dragoons ignite a hard-fought battle.
Ore to Kanojo no Love Comedy ga Zenryoku de Kuro Rekishi is a school comedy about Ryuki Kurosu, a high-school boy stuck in an all-boys school who desperately wants the romantic-comedy youth he imagines. His overeager pursuit of encounters turns into a chain of embarrassing incidents.
A yearning for romantic comedy turns into a full-force embarrassing past.
Published as Moebuta ni Tsugu: Dramatic Revenge Story, this high-energy romantic comedy centers on Moezo, a cross-dressing school idol whose cheerful persona hides a desire for revenge. The arrival of a fairy of moe turns that grudge into a chaotic psychological comedy.
A scheming revenge comedy begins when a fairy of moe becomes a tool for payback.
The award-submission title was retitled for publication as Intelligentsia-buru Suiri Shoujo to Hametai Sensei: In Terrible Silly Show, Jawed at Hermitlike SENSEI. It follows a literature-club adviser known as Sensei and the middle-school literary girl Rei Hirasaka, who believes the world runs by logic, as they enter a battle of wits and emotional tension on an isolated island.
On an isolated island, a battle over logic and randomness entangles itself with romance.
